GENERAL SPECIFICATIONS
Brake:
Front brake type Single disc brake
Operation Right hand operation
Rear brake type Single disc brake
Operation Right foot operation
Suspension:
Front suspension Telescopic fork
Rear suspension Swingarm (link type monocross suspension)
Shock absorber:
Front shock absorber Coil spring/oil damper
Rear shock absorber Coil spring/gas, oil damper
Wheel travel:
Front wheel travel 300 mm (11.8 in)
Rear wheel travel 315 mm (12.4 in)
Electrical:
Ignition system CDI magneto

MAINTENANCE SPECIFICATIONS
Lubrication system:
Oil filter type Wire mesh type ----
Oil pump type Trochoid type ----
Tip clearance 0.12 mm or less
(0.0047 in or less)0.20 mm
(0.008 in)
Side clearance 0.09 ~ 0.17 mm
(0.0035 ~ 0.0067 in)0.24 mm
(0.009 in)
Housing and rotor clearance 0.03 ~ 0.10 mm
(0.0012 ~ 0.0039 in)0.17 mm
(0.0067 in)
Cooling:
Radiator core size
Width 107.8 mm (4.2 in) ----
Height 220 mm (8.7 in) ----
Thickness 32 mm (1.26 in) ----
Radiator cap opening pressure110 kPa (1.1 kg/cm
2
, 15.6 psi)----
Radiator capacity (total) 0.56 L (0.49 lmp qt, 0.59 US qt) ----
Water pump
Type Single-suction centrifugal pump ----Item Standard Limit
